UNPKG

@message-queue-toolkit/sns

Version:
40 lines 4.63 kB
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.FakeConsumer = exports.generateTopicSubscriptionPolicy = exports.generateFilterAttributes = exports.readSnsMessage = exports.initSnsSqs = exports.initSns = exports.subscribeToTopic = exports.clearCachedCallerIdentity = exports.getSubscriptionAttributes = exports.findSubscriptionByTopicAndQueue = exports.deleteSubscription = exports.getTopicAttributes = exports.deleteTopic = exports.assertTopic = exports.deserializeSNSMessage = exports.AbstractSnsSqsConsumer = exports.AbstractSnsPublisher = exports.SnsConsumerErrorResolver = exports.AbstractSnsService = exports.SNS_MESSAGE_MAX_SIZE = void 0; const tslib_1 = require("tslib"); var AbstractSnsService_1 = require("./lib/sns/AbstractSnsService"); Object.defineProperty(exports, "SNS_MESSAGE_MAX_SIZE", { enumerable: true, get: function () { return AbstractSnsService_1.SNS_MESSAGE_MAX_SIZE; } }); var AbstractSnsService_2 = require("./lib/sns/AbstractSnsService"); Object.defineProperty(exports, "AbstractSnsService", { enumerable: true, get: function () { return AbstractSnsService_2.AbstractSnsService; } }); var SnsConsumerErrorResolver_1 = require("./lib/errors/SnsConsumerErrorResolver"); Object.defineProperty(exports, "SnsConsumerErrorResolver", { enumerable: true, get: function () { return SnsConsumerErrorResolver_1.SnsConsumerErrorResolver; } }); var AbstractSnsPublisher_1 = require("./lib/sns/AbstractSnsPublisher"); Object.defineProperty(exports, "AbstractSnsPublisher", { enumerable: true, get: function () { return AbstractSnsPublisher_1.AbstractSnsPublisher; } }); var AbstractSnsSqsConsumer_1 = require("./lib/sns/AbstractSnsSqsConsumer"); Object.defineProperty(exports, "AbstractSnsSqsConsumer", { enumerable: true, get: function () { return AbstractSnsSqsConsumer_1.AbstractSnsSqsConsumer; } }); var snsMessageDeserializer_1 = require("./lib/utils/snsMessageDeserializer"); Object.defineProperty(exports, "deserializeSNSMessage", { enumerable: true, get: function () { return snsMessageDeserializer_1.deserializeSNSMessage; } }); var snsUtils_1 = require("./lib/utils/snsUtils"); Object.defineProperty(exports, "assertTopic", { enumerable: true, get: function () { return snsUtils_1.assertTopic; } }); Object.defineProperty(exports, "deleteTopic", { enumerable: true, get: function () { return snsUtils_1.deleteTopic; } }); Object.defineProperty(exports, "getTopicAttributes", { enumerable: true, get: function () { return snsUtils_1.getTopicAttributes; } }); Object.defineProperty(exports, "deleteSubscription", { enumerable: true, get: function () { return snsUtils_1.deleteSubscription; } }); Object.defineProperty(exports, "findSubscriptionByTopicAndQueue", { enumerable: true, get: function () { return snsUtils_1.findSubscriptionByTopicAndQueue; } }); Object.defineProperty(exports, "getSubscriptionAttributes", { enumerable: true, get: function () { return snsUtils_1.getSubscriptionAttributes; } }); var stsUtils_1 = require("./lib/utils/stsUtils"); Object.defineProperty(exports, "clearCachedCallerIdentity", { enumerable: true, get: function () { return stsUtils_1.clearCachedCallerIdentity; } }); var snsSubscriber_1 = require("./lib/utils/snsSubscriber"); Object.defineProperty(exports, "subscribeToTopic", { enumerable: true, get: function () { return snsSubscriber_1.subscribeToTopic; } }); var snsInitter_1 = require("./lib/utils/snsInitter"); Object.defineProperty(exports, "initSns", { enumerable: true, get: function () { return snsInitter_1.initSns; } }); Object.defineProperty(exports, "initSnsSqs", { enumerable: true, get: function () { return snsInitter_1.initSnsSqs; } }); var snsMessageReader_1 = require("./lib/utils/snsMessageReader"); Object.defineProperty(exports, "readSnsMessage", { enumerable: true, get: function () { return snsMessageReader_1.readSnsMessage; } }); var snsAttributeUtils_1 = require("./lib/utils/snsAttributeUtils"); Object.defineProperty(exports, "generateFilterAttributes", { enumerable: true, get: function () { return snsAttributeUtils_1.generateFilterAttributes; } }); Object.defineProperty(exports, "generateTopicSubscriptionPolicy", { enumerable: true, get: function () { return snsAttributeUtils_1.generateTopicSubscriptionPolicy; } }); tslib_1.__exportStar(require("./lib/sns/CommonSnsPublisherFactory"), exports); tslib_1.__exportStar(require("./lib/sns/SnsPublisherManager"), exports); var FakeConsumer_1 = require("./lib/sns/fakes/FakeConsumer"); Object.defineProperty(exports, "FakeConsumer", { enumerable: true, get: function () { return FakeConsumer_1.FakeConsumer; } }); //# sourceMappingURL=index.js.map